Almost new set of 911, 991.1 C2 winter, replica wheels and mounted (4) Blizzak LM-32 with about 750 miles on the set. TPMS is already working and the wheels are mounted, balanced, and ready to be just thrown on. These wheels and tires were a Christmas gift for me and my 991.1 C2 for my local Winter Autocross last December, but I moved and the commute is 40 miles each way, so I sold the 911. TPMS is already working and the wheels are mounted, balanced, and ready to be just thrown on to your car. They have never seen salt, and the only snow was at the Road America Winter autocross where I took second in the RWD class behind a prepped Miata. These winter wheels and tires are going to be a huge gain and huge value for one of you.

Wheel size- (2) F: 19x8.5 with almost new 225/45 R19 96V Blizzak LM-32s. Offset 50mm
(2) R: 19x11 with almost new 275/40 R19 101V Blizzak LM-32s. Offset 60mm

I wanted the narrowest tire with the largest profile I could do on these new rims for maximum traction on the ice. The rim protection lips on the both the front and back tires don't quite protect the lip of the rims. These wheels do not rub on any of the car. They're actually much smoother than the stock 325 and 275 20's my 991.1 originally have on.
